Output 621be1390b991796bca4e50b241b873a006c2cc728600ad0ee48f12d3598b1e7:0

value
655297
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0fafadd3765948182ec925fa3560729c80bdb92a OP_EQUAL
address
337xWp65ifuQRZMxcq5kkSWR7i6RbHDe3v
transaction
621be1390b991796bca4e50b241b873a006c2cc728600ad0ee48f12d3598b1e7
spent
true